Grammar Quiz

[ Verb Tenses ]

She apologized because she …………….my birthday.

A. forgot

B. was forgetting

C. had forgotten

D. has forgotten

Select your answer:
A  B  C  D  E 


Random Topics:

Present Tense vs Past TenseAuxiliary Verbs & Question TagsConjunctions & InterjectionsReported Speech and SubjunctiveAsking for and Giving OpinionTenses StructurePrepositions of TimeAdverbial ClausesParticiple AdjectivesSimple Past Tense (was/were)

Other quiz:

Grammar › View

_______ hiking with my friends was fantastic. We had a _________time last Sunday.

A. Go, enjoyable

B. To go, painful

C. Goes, awful

D. Going, wonderful


Grammar › View

You …. your homework.

A. didn’t do

B. didn’t done

C. did not done

Grammar › View

The five interlacing rings ___ the official symbol of the Olympic games.
a. are
b. have to be
c. are being


Present Simple and Continuous › View

Pocky rides a motorcycle to school __________.

A. every day

B. right now

C. at the moment

D. next week